Our practitioners outside Australia: an overview

Every practitioner on InnerHub is a trained professional with a university degree in psychology or counselling, and many hold a masters or postgraduate qualification on top of that. In countries like Brazil, that first degree is typically five years of full-time clinical study before you are eligible to practise at all. Alongside the formal training, they bring years of real experience supporting people through exactly the things our clients come to us with. We review practitioners' core qualifications, professional memberships and insurance as part of our onboarding before they see a client. Every profile states:

  • The degree, the institution, and the country it was earned in
  • Years of experience and the languages they work in
  • Matched to what you want to work on, and free to change if the fit is not right

Practitioners are not registered in Australia (AHPRA): they are trained and qualified in their own countries instead, and they do not use Australian protected titles.

InnerHub is not a clinical service: our practitioners do not diagnose conditions or prescribe medication.

How to read a profile

What the titles mean

Every practitioner on InnerHub is a trained professional with a university degree in psychology or counselling, and each appears under the plain title of therapist, with the actual credentials written out underneath: degree, institution, country, years of practice and languages, so you can weigh the substance yourself.

Practitioners are not registered in Australia (AHPRA): they are trained and qualified in their own countries instead, and they do not use Australian protected titles. The full explanation is on Our Standards.
